Title: Ebonite Tiger upgrade or Second Ball Choice
Post by: Meg on December 06, 2004, 04:24:42 AM
Hi I have been using the Ebonite Tiger ball for almost 4 years now. It has a lot of games on it. I am hoping to upgrade or look for a good second ball choice. I bowl on synthetic lanes with a medium oil pattern.  I bowl two back to back leagues one night and every other week another league.  I have been averaging 180+ since using the Tiger.  I usually bowl over the second arrow, go long and then have a nice arc to the pocket.  It seems lately as the night goes on the Tiger takes off and must hit really hard in the pocket as I will leave a dumb split like the 8-10 on what appears to look like a pocket hit.  I would appreciate any input or Tiger users on what they think about a new ball choice.  I bowl medium speed for a female and would say have low to medium rev rate on the ball.  Thanks Meg

If you are happy with what teh iger is dloing for you then I suggest you follow Phatdon's advice and look into the ShowTimes. They utilize the same core as the Tiger but have an updated coverstock.

If you are looking for a little more reaction, look into the PrimeTimes series. The core shape is different and you get a particle instead of resin coverstock but I still think it would be an option if you want more reaction.The core/ coverstock should provide a bit earlier roll and more hook in the wet stuff if that's what you want.

There is an upgrade to the Tiger?

I bet your ball is either oil logged or that the surface has gotten too dull leading to lack of energy at the pocket.

8 -10 s are often a result of roll out.  This can easily happen as one bowls a pearl ball starts to gravitate to 600 grit over time due to friction with the lane.

A rejuvination and resurface may make you think that Tiger is brand new.

Otherwise like said the Showtime pearl is new and available at a proshop near you!
